How Does It Work?
Now, let’s dive into how this amazing tool works! The Olympus Innov-X Alpha DC-2000 uses X-ray fluorescence (XRF) to analyze materials. Here’s a simple way to understand it:
- Sending Out X-rays: When you point the device at a material, it sends out a type of energy called X-rays. Think of X-rays like invisible light that can see through things.
- Exciting Atoms: When the X-rays hit the atoms in the material, they cause the atoms to become excited. This means the atoms release energy in the form of light.
- Detecting Elements: The device captures this light and analyzes it. Each element gives off a unique pattern of light. By looking at these patterns, the Innov-X Alpha DC-2000 can tell what elements are in the material.
Why is X-Ray Fluorescence Important?
X-ray fluorescence is important because it allows scientists and engineers to analyze materials without damaging them. This is crucial in many fields, such as:
- Environmental Science: To check if soil or water is safe and free from harmful substances.
- Manufacturing: To ensure that materials used in products are of high quality and meet safety standards.
- Recycling: To identify what materials can be recycled and how to do it properly.
